Output 3092c6e349ae25fa55f2a7d81593f89541af9984d336b1b182aab532de792c49:4

value
697350858
script pubkey
OP_0 OP_PUSHBYTES_20 24b5d5a58615e91f7c8f03c58bfe4d2d7411f356
address
bc1qyj6atfvxzh537ly0q0zchljd946pru6ktdmaty
transaction
3092c6e349ae25fa55f2a7d81593f89541af9984d336b1b182aab532de792c49
spent
true